Windows 10 發(fā)布時提供了 32 位和 64 位版本供大家選擇,微軟從 Vista 開始就一直這么在做,這也形成了微軟發(fā)布客戶端操作系統(tǒng)時非約定俗成的慣例。那么,任務(wù)普通用戶要如何進行操作系統(tǒng)的 32 or 64 位架構(gòu)選擇呢?
首先要說的是,不論是 32 位還是 64 位 Windows 10,在用戶能夠使用的功能上是沒有任何差別的。那么,你可能會產(chǎn)生疑惑了:微軟為啥還要區(qū)分 32 位和 64 位呢?其實,我們只需要讓各位了解 64 位技術(shù)相較 32 位的優(yōu)勢,大家就自然明白各中原由了。
32位與64位Windows 10的區(qū)別
64 位與 32 位的不同之處眾多,其中用戶感覺最為明顯的就是內(nèi)存尋址空間的不同。我們就僅以“適用”的內(nèi)存大小來舉例。計算機內(nèi)存的大小對性能有著決定性的影響,32 位寄存器最大尋址空間為 232這就決定了 32 位 Windows 10的最大內(nèi)存尋址空間為 232 即 4 GB。以此類推,64 位操作系統(tǒng)的內(nèi)存尋址空間為264,我們可以理解為無窮大的內(nèi)存空間。因此,64 位 ≠ 32 位 X 2,他們尋址空間(即能夠使用的內(nèi)存大小)差別根本不在一個數(shù)量級。
32 位Windows 10 操作系統(tǒng)支持最大內(nèi)存為 4 GB,我的主板也支持 4 GB 內(nèi)存,為何操作系統(tǒng)提示我的系統(tǒng)內(nèi)存使用不到 4 GB 呢?
首先要解釋我們時常所說的操作系統(tǒng)可以支持到多大內(nèi)存,其實指的是操作系統(tǒng)所支持的內(nèi)存尋址空間。一般來說 32 位的操作系統(tǒng),其內(nèi)存尋址空間的上限是 4 GB。這個數(shù)值是如何得到呢?因為計算機內(nèi)部使用 2 進制計數(shù),所以 32 位系統(tǒng)的最大計數(shù)范圍是 232 即 4GB,但這 4 GB 并不能全部用來供內(nèi)存使用。首先,主板 BIOS 或 UEFI 會占用 512 KB 或更多,當(dāng)然這是個很小的數(shù)字;其次,系統(tǒng)需要為各種 PCI、PCI-E 設(shè)備保留相當(dāng)部分的尋址空間,以便系統(tǒng)可以找到并使用他們,這部分一般在幾百 MB;隨后,計算機內(nèi)還有個需要占據(jù)大量尋址空間的設(shè)備——顯卡。不同的顯存容量,也需要占據(jù)相對的尋址空間(集成顯卡這部分將與內(nèi)存共享)。事實上,真正可以被拿來使用的內(nèi)存空間約在 3 GB 到 3.5 GB 之間。例如,如果你使用獨立顯卡,并使用了4GB內(nèi)存條的話,真正可以被使用的內(nèi)存只有 3 GB 左右。剩余的一部分內(nèi)存因為沒有尋址空間進行編碼,所以也無法被使用。
而 64 位系統(tǒng)則支持的范圍更大,理論上 64 位系統(tǒng)可以支持 264 次方尋址空間。目前 64 位 的 Windows 10 可支持的內(nèi)存大小最高可以到 512 GB。
查看硬件是否支持64位
由于 32 位與 64 位 Windows 10 在功能特性上沒有區(qū)別,又能夠支持更多的內(nèi)存和其它硬件特性及硬件安全特性,而且 64 位操作系統(tǒng)已經(jīng)成為當(dāng)前的主流趨勢。在有可能的情況下,還是建議大家都安裝 64 位 Windows 10。但在安裝 64 位系統(tǒng)之前,我們還需要確認當(dāng)前電腦的硬件,主要是 CPU 和主板是否兼容 64 位。Windows 10 x64 要求 CPU 至少支持 PAE、NX 和 SSE2 指令集,否則將無法進行安裝。
要確認當(dāng)前計算機的 CPU 是否支持以上指令集,我們可以使用兩種工具來查看:
使用圖形界面CPU-Z
如果支持 SSE2 指令集將直接在界面中進行顯示,如果出現(xiàn) EM64T 或 AMD64 指令集表示支持 PAE 技術(shù),如果出現(xiàn) VT-x 或 VT-d 則表示支持 NX 技術(shù)。
CPU-Z 下載
使用命令行工具Coreinfo
如果你是技術(shù)控,可以使用 Sysinternals 的命令行工具 Coreinfo 來查看 CPU 所支持的指令集。
CoreInfo 下載
其它事項
- 即使你的 CPU 和主板都能夠支持 64 位特性,還需要確認一下硬件設(shè)備是否有提供 64 位驅(qū)動,
- 當(dāng)然 Windows 10 都內(nèi)置了非常多常見及主流硬件的 64 位驅(qū)動,一般安裝上就可以識別大多數(shù)硬件。如果微軟沒有內(nèi)置驅(qū)動,還可以通過 Windows Update 來啟用或禁用驅(qū)動更新。
- 如果都一切就緒了,我們就可以去下載 64 位 Windows 10 來進行安裝。
|